visibility
Оновлено: 05.12.2022
visibility
Призначений для відображення або приховування елемента, включно з рамкою навколо нього і тлом. Під час приховування елемента, хоча його і стає не видно, місце, яке елемент займає, залишається за ним. Якщо передбачається виведення різних елементів в одне й те саме місце екрана, для обходу цієї особливості слід використовувати абсолютне позиціонування або скористатися властивістю display.
Коротка інформація
Значення за замовчуванням | visible |
---|---|
Успадковується | Так |
Застосовується | До всіх елементів |
Анімується | Так |
Синтаксис
visibility: visible | hidden | collapse
Значення
visible | Відображає елемент як видимий. |
hidden | Елемент стає невидимим або правильніше сказати, повністю прозорим, оскільки він продовжує брати участь у форматуванні сторінки. |
collapse | Якщо це значення застосовується не до рядків або колонок таблиці, то результат його використання буде таким самим, як hidden. У разі використання collapse для вмісту клітинок таблиць, то вони реагують, немов до них було додано display: none. Іншими словами, задані рядки і колонки прибираються, а таблиця перебудовується за новою. |
Приклад
Об'єктна модель
Об'єкт.style.visibility